<p>Extreme weather conditions have been a source of inspiration through the years for various ambient composers, just think of Robert Rich («Calling down the Sky») or Steve Roach («Slow Heat», «Storm Warning»).</p>
<p>With «Arte Magnetica» Spanish sound sculptor Max Corbacho delivers his contribution to the subject painting an aural panorama of lush textural expansiveness along slow shapeshifting farscapes echoing the impact and tranquility of long hot summer days. These absorbing, gently morphing and embracing soundscapes travel into the deeper end visiting darker corners on «Monolith» and «Telluric» while starting to resurge into the light gradually from mysterious depths and clouds of dense spheres on the last two tracks of «Arte Magnetica».<br />Nice going Max!</p>

<h4>Bert Strolenberg, www.sonicimmersion.org</h4>
<p>«Nocturnal Emanations is the 4th album of the Spanish ambientcomposer Max Corbacho, which again is worth the long wait. It features typical quiet longform ambient-spacemusic divided in 8 tracks, in which transparent synthwashes slowly develop and desolve. A certain comparison to the current ambient excursions and light drone-textural worlds of his US collegue Steve Roach (again) can&#8217;t be denied, but next to that, Corbacho has arranged a beautiful backing with a vast aray of environmental sounds and fx&#8217;s, giving the musical painting an almost dense atmosphere. The slow flowing and morphing soundscapes, sometimes accompanied by distinct ambient percussion and sequencertreats (in which a slight high-tech component like Vir Unis is obvious), even gain effect when experienced in the evening or at night when using headphones. Stillness and introspectiveness all make up for over 73 highly atmospheric music, which seems to be the standard for such recordings since a few years.»</p>
